HAM AND CHEESE PUFF

This recipe is an absolute winner for brunch, lunch or whenever. People really seem to go for the big chunks of ham combined with the flavors of mustard and cheese. Because it's assembled the night before, it is a nifty make-ahead potluck dish. -Nina Clark, Wareham, Massachusetts

Time 1h10m

Yield 2 casseroles (12 servings each).

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 loaves (1 pound each) Italian bread, cut into 1-inch cubes
6 cups cubed fully cooked ham
1-1/2 pounds Monterey Jack or Muenster cheese, cubed
1 medium onion, chopped
1/4 cup butter
16 large eggs
7 cups whole milk
1/2 cup prepared mustard

Steps:

  • Toss bread, ham and cheese; divide between 2 greased 13x9-in. baking dishes. In a skillet, saute onion in butter until tender; transfer to a bowl. Add eggs, milk and mustard; mix well. Pour over bread mixture. Cover and refrigerate overnight. , Remove from the ref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 55-65 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Serve immediately.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 369 calories, Fat 19g fat (9g saturated fat), Cholesterol 187mg cholesterol, Sodium 949mg sodium, Carbohydrate 24g carbohydrate (5g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 25g protein.
